Dolly, CAT is an entrance examination for admission to Post Graduate Management Programmes. The minimum eligibility for appearing in CAT is that you should have secured a minimum aggregate of 50% in your Bachelor's degree in any discipline. Now you haven't mentioned your Graduation percentage. It is 50% for General Category and 45% for Reserved Categories.
